    Quote Originally Posted by kraner View Post
    Yeah, so much for an explanation. Still not clear if you need to win a ranked game in the bracket.
    How is it not clear? "If you’ve filled up your Conquest bar for the week, you’ll receive a reward in the chest of an appropriate item level. The item level of the reward will be based on the highest bracket in which you won at least one game last week. "

    https://worldofwarcraft.com/en-us/ne...rating-updates

    We've known for almost 3 months now that you need to fill up conquest, and win a game, for the weekly pvp chest. Everyone's acting like its sudden news...

    Like the blue clarification posted, we all get one «bar» to fill of conquest per week. If you ignore pvp for 5 weeks, you have 5 bars with gear to fill at your convenience. The requirement to get the weekly PvP chest is to fill at least one conquest bar throughout the week, and potentially to play/win X amount of games (feel like I’ve read 3 somewhere) in a bracket to make that bracket decide the ilvl of your weekly chest reward.

    So to get the most out of weekly pvp, you have to fill your conquest bar each week, and make sure you play games in whatever bracket you want to decide your reward. Hope that helps.
